Cumin and Pomegranate Infused Beetroot, halloumi & courgette kebabs in lime & toasted cumin seed dressing

The infused beetroot in this recipe provides a quick and easy way to add extra flavour and colour, creating a seriously tasty light summer supper or vegetarian option to add to a BBQ spread.

Serves: 2
Preparation time: 10 minutes
Cooking time: 10 minutes

You’ll need:

1 tsp cumin seeds
½ lime juiced
1tbsp olive oil
200g Halloumi, torn into bite sized chunks
4 Cumin & Pomegranate Infused Beetroot, cut into quarters
4 spring onions, cut into 3cm battens
1 small courgette, sliced into disks
4 kebab sticks

What to do:

  • If using wooden kebab sticks, soak them in water before using so they don’t burn on the bbq.
  • In a small frying pan, toast the cumin seeds for a minute or two until they become fragrant, take care not to burn them. Remove from the heat and stir in the lime juice and oil and season well.
  • Tip the veg and halloumi into a large bowl, pour over the dressing and combine well to coat. Thread the veg and cheese onto kebab sticks, reserving any dressing left in the bowl. Cook for 4-5 minutes on each side the BBQ or under the grill, until the cheese is browned and crisp on the outside and the veg is cooked.
  • Pour the reserved dressing onto a serving plate. Once cooked turn the kebabs on the serving plate to soak up the remaining dressing.
